Because they don't have any shifting components that might need upkeep or fuels that may need replenishment, solar cells offer electric power for most Room installations, from communications and temperature satellites to Room stations. (Solar electric power is insufficient for Room probes despatched into the outer planets of the solar system or into interstellar space, however, due to diffusion of radiant energy with length through the Sunlight.) Solar cells have also been Utilized in buyer items, like Digital toys, handheld calculators, and transportable radios. Solar cells Utilized in units of this kind may perhaps make the most of artificial mild (e.g., from incandescent and fluorescent lamps) as well as sunlight.
